sym_difference

書式 sym_difference(Array1, Array2)

引数
Array1:配列1
Array2:配列2

説明

Array1Array2の格納値のいずれかにしか含まれていない値を格納した配列を返します(対象差)。
Array1、Array2の格納値は常に数値として評価します。
また、返り値となる配列をは常にuniqueで昇順の配列です。
Array1、Array2のいずれかが配列でない場合は、空値(非配列)を返します。


記述例1

var $array1 = [ 1, 2, 3, 4 ];


var $array2 = [ 2, 4, 6 ];


var $result = sym_difference( $array1, $array2 );

-------------------------------------------
[結果例] $resultは 「1,3,6」 です。


記述例2

■Q1000とQ1100の選択がかぶっていない選択肢一覧(対象差)


var $sel = sym_difference( Q1000.S, Q1100.S );

  戻る